A junior contacted the high school vice-principal to report that another junior student, Richard Dickens, was selling marijuana in the school parking lot. The vice-principal had received reports that Dickens was involved with drugs before from a senior who had provided the vice-principal with reliable information about illegal activities of other students in the past.

The vice-principal then called Dickens into his office and asked him to empty his pockets. Dickens was carrying $230 cash in small bills and a piece of paper with a telephone pager number on it. The vice-principal knew that drug dealers often use pagers. The vice-principal called school security who searched Dickens's locker but found nothing.

When the vice-principal told Dickens they would have to search his car, which was parked in the school lot, Dickens refused. After speaking to Dickens's mother by phone, Dickens turned over the keys. The school officials found a pager and a notebook inside the car. The notebook had names with dollar amounts written next to the names. They opened the locked trunk of the car and found a locked briefcase. Dickens first said he didn't know who owned the briefcase; then he said a friend owned it and that he did not know the combination. The school security officers pried it open and discovered 80.2 grams of marijuana. Police were called and Dickens was arrested.

Dickens claims that the searches of his official person, his locker, car, and locked briefcase were unconstitutional. Decide if the searches were constitutional and give your reasons.
